Chronic Subdural Hematoma with Symptoms of Leg and Back Pain

Abstract
|
|
|
We report a case of chronic subdural hematoma of the brain, which was identified during a spine examination. A 65-year-old woman presented with progressive weakness in the left leg, which had persisted for 20 days. She had been experiencing chronic lower back pain and left leg pain since 7 years, for which she received nerve block and physical therapy. However, in our clinic, neurological examination revealed left hemiparesis, and scout-view magnetic resonance imaging revealed chronic subdural hematoma of the brain. This was confirmed by computed tomography findings. Thorough examination and accurate diagnostic tests are essential in the differential diagnosis of all patients presenting with hemiparesis, even when the symptoms resemble those associated with a cervical lesion.
